Output df18818575a4e34f6b4336656b33fe6a3b29b8e17c0445d467011aa028bc91dc:13

value
2893
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 99f31ec320c3d21d57cb1d2e3a1b1f62410e3f8199647d0b2ae2a2646327fc9e
address
bc1pn8e3aseqc0fp647tr5hr5xclvfqsu0upn9j86ze2u23xgce8lj0qaak5q8
transaction
df18818575a4e34f6b4336656b33fe6a3b29b8e17c0445d467011aa028bc91dc
spent
true